Webb12 dec. 2013 · Wetlands provide areas for aquifer recharge, retention of flood waters and fish and wildlife habitat. They also naturally protect water quality. Therefore, permits are required for work in wetlands. Coastal Wetlands Coastal, or saltwater, wetlands consist of salt marshes and mangrove swamps. Webb28 jan. 2016 · Miami Beach Stormwater Infrastructure Adaptation. The City of Miami-Beach is taking action to protect Miami Beach roads ... 14 th, and 17 th Streets, a new sanitary sewer main, a new water main and service line, and upsizing sections of the storm water drainage system. The contract also involves elevating roadways by two feet ...
